Mumbai, Feb 17 (NationPress) The talented actress Saumya Tandon has openly expressed her unwavering affection for India's beloved street food, pani puri, emphasizing that her love for this tangy treat will remain eternal.

Taking to Instagram, Saumya shared a delightful snapshot of a paper bowl filled with pani puri. She playfully captioned it, “pani puri… Yeh pyaar na hoga kam,” clearly showcasing that her passion for this culinary delight is steadfast.

Recently, she appeared in the blockbuster film Dhurandhar, directed by Aditya Dhar. The movie features an impressive ensemble cast including Akshaye Khanna, Ranveer Singh, R. Madhavan, Arjun Rampal, Sanjay Dutt, Sara Arjun, and Rakesh Bedi, alongside supporting roles by Manav Gohil, Danish Pandor, Saumya Tandon, Gaurav Gera, and Naveen Kaushik.

This film is inspired by real-life events connected to geopolitical tensions and covert operations of India's R&AW, particularly focusing on Operation Lyari and the 2008 Mumbai attacks, as well as crackdowns on gangs and criminal syndicates.

Saumya began her career with modeling and was the Femina Cover Girl First Runner Up in 2006. She also starred in the Afghan series Khushi in 2008, portraying a lead Afghan woman doctor. Additionally, she co-hosted Zor Ka Jhatka: Total Wipeout with Shah Rukh Khan and hosted Dance India Dance for three seasons, along with co-hosting the Bournvita Quiz Contest with Derek O’Brien.

In Imtiaz Ali's Jab We Met, featuring Shahid Kapoor and Kareena Kapoor, she played Roop, Kareena’s sister. Since 2015, Tandon has been recognized for her role as Anita in the comedy series Bhabiji Ghar Par Hain!, affectionately known as “gori mem” due to her character's interactions. In 2018, she hosted the second season of Entertainment Ki Raat.
